Subject

COBRA Premium Reduction and Extended Eligibility Provisions in the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009

Purpose

To increase awareness of the Consolidated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act of 1985 (COBRA) provisions in the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 and inform states and local areas about resources available to assist dislocated workers, businesses, and partners in understanding the new law.

Subject

American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 Competitive Grants for Green Job Training

Purpose

The American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 (Recovery Act) was signed into law by President Obama on February 17, 2009. The Recovery Act is intended to preserve and create jobs, promote the nation's economic recovery, and assist those most impacted by the recession. Among other funding directed toward the Department of Labor (DOL), the Recovery Act provides $750 million for a program of competitive grants for worker training and placement in high growth and emerging industries. Of the $750 million allotted for competitive grants, the Recovery Act designates $500 million for projects that prepare workers for careers in the energy efficiency and renewable energy sectors described in Section 171(e)(1)(B) of the Workforce Investment Act of 1998 (WIA), as amended to incorporate the Green Jobs Act of 2007. This notice describes the Employment and Training Administration's (ETA) initial plans for awarding these "green job training" funds under the Recovery Act so that interested organizations can begin to plan for the application process and can strengthen or build partnerships to be successful applicants.

Subject

Reporting Training-Related Employment under the Workforce Investment Act (WIA) Programs

Purpose

This Training and Employment Notice (TEN) is intended to improve reporting on training related employment for WIA programs. The TEN begins with general overview of the current state of the training-related employment and occupation information in the Workforce Investment Act Standardized Record Data (WIASRD) for individuals that obtained employment after program exit. Second, this TEN presents the challenges associated with collecting this information. Lastly, the TEN will present some state practices on effective ways to collect and report on training-related employment for WIA exiters who received training and obtained employment.
